A new era begins for historic school site - Construction Specifier

C.W. Driver Companies broke ground on the $175-million modernization of Long Beach Polytechnic High School in Los Angeles County. Photo courtesy LPA Architects  C.W. Driver Companies broke ground on the $175-million modernization of Long Beach Polytechnic High School in Los Angeles County. The project will be executed in three strategic phases. The first will focus on site improvements, utility upgrades, and interim housing facilities to prepare…
